News: Apple opening Maps development office in India

<img src="(http://assets.ilounge.com/images/uploads/hyderabadmap.jpg)" />

                
            
               Apple has announced the opening of a new office in Hyderabad, India to focus on the development of the Apple Maps platform. Apple expects to employ up to 4,000 people in the new facility, to be located on the Waverock campus, which will help accelerate the development of the Maps infrastructure for Apple’s iOS and OS X devices. “Apple is focused on making the best products and services in the world and we are thrilled to open this new office…
